文本区域控件在换行时会在控件的值中插入一个换行符的原因是为了保持文本的格式和可读性。换行符的插入可以让文本在显示时按照用户输入的格式进行换行,以便更好地展示长文本内容。
这种设计有以下几个优势:
- 格式保持:文本区域控件通常用于输入或展示较长的文本内容,如文章、评论等。插入换行符可以保持用户输入的文本格式,使其在展示时保持原有的段落、换行等格式。
- 可读性:插入换行符可以提高文本的可读性,使长文本更易于阅读和理解。换行符的插入可以将长文本分成多行,避免出现过长的行导致阅读困难。
- 界面美观:换行符的插入可以使文本区域控件的显示界面更加美观。通过合理的换行,可以避免文本溢出控件边界或超出屏幕范围,提升用户体验。
文本区域控件在各种应用场景中都有广泛的应用,例如:
- 在网页表单中,用于用户输入较长的文本内容,如评论、留言等。
- 在文本编辑器或富文本编辑器中,用于编辑和展示文章、博客等长文本内容。
- 在聊天应用中,用于显示聊天记录,支持多行输入和展示。
腾讯云提供了一系列与文本区域控件相关的产品和服务,例如:
- 云服务器(Elastic Compute Cloud,ECS):提供了虚拟化的计算资源,可用于搭建和部署包含文本区域控件的应用程序。详情请参考:云服务器产品介绍
- 云数据库MySQL版(TencentDB for MySQL):提供了稳定可靠的关系型数据库服务,可用于存储和管理应用程序中的文本数据。详情请参考:云数据库MySQL版产品介绍
- 云函数(Serverless Cloud Function,SCF):提供了无服务器的计算服务,可用于处理和分析文本数据。详情请参考:云函数产品介绍
通过使用腾讯云的相关产品和服务,开发人员可以轻松构建和部署支持文本区域控件的应用程序,并享受高性能、高可用性的云计算服务。